B. individuals, private companies, and charities should do it.<br /><br />During the Great Depression, President Herbert Hoover believed that the economy would recover on its own without significant government intervention. He emphasized the importance of individualism and self-reliance, and he encouraged private companies and charities to take the lead in providing assistance to those in need. This approach, however, was widely criticized as inadequate and ineffective in addressing the severity of the economic crisis. As a result, many Americans were dissatisfied with Hoover's response and sought more active government intervention to alleviate the hardships of the Depression.
